The three components of the aerobic respiratory metabolism of sablefish, digestion (SDA), activity, and standard metabolism, were examined separately and together as dependent variables responding to the independent variable, feeding frequency. All fish were similar in size and held within a temperature range of 8.5 - 9.5 C on a 12 hr photoperiod. Fish were studied in both 4000 L mass respirometers equipped with activity meters and in a tunnel respirometer. Identical meals were given every 4, 7, and 14 days. Spexin (SPX), also called neuropeptide Q (NPQ), is a novel neuropeptide discovered recently using the bioinformatic approach. Except for mammals, SPX has not been reported in lower vertebrates including fish and amphibians. Following its discovery, the biological functions of this peptide in both higher and lower vertebrates are still largely unknown. To examine the structure and functions of SPX in fish model, molecular cloning of goldfish SPX has been performed and found to be highly comparable to its mammalian counterparts. This study aimed to investigate the feeding behaviour of the calanoid copepod, Pseudodiaptomus hessei, particularly whether it prefers to feed on a planktonic or benthic food source. The effect of different microalgae species on the feeding preference, ingestion, and gut evacuation rate were investigated. Two microalgae species (Isochrysis galbana and Tetraselmis suecica) were used, to test gut fullness and gut evacuation of P. hessei. The copepods were starved for 6 h and allowed to feed on monalgae diets, I .galbana and T. suecica, and a 1:1 binary diet mixture of T. suecica and I. galbana.

A study has been carried out to investigate some aspects of the feeding and digestion of the parasitic copepod Lepeophtheirus salmonis (Kreyer, 1837), a serious pathogen of wild and farmed marine salmonids. The alimentary canal consists of a cuticularised foregut and hindgut and a midgut, the latter comprising most of the length of the alimentary canal. It consisted of an anterior diverticulum, and anterior midgut, mid midgut and posterior midgut. All the midgut is lined in the luminal side with a monolayer of digestive epithelium. In Thailand, culture and production of a high value freshwater fish, the marble goby, is dependant upon farm-made feeds using marine and freshwater trash fish as primary ingredients. However, there is lack of nutritional research regarding the use of such farm-made feeds and their impacts on the nutritional status, growth and health of marble goby. The aims of the present study were to evaluate the effects of farm- made feeds on slaughter indices, fish lipid classes and fatty acid profiles, nutrient composition and digestibility.
